Hi guys. I haven’t posted much here but I figured I’d post a find. One day a month back or so I was throwing some scrap metal out at the dump, my oldest spotted a chainsaw in the pile. Now I was not going to grab a dump saw, it’s there for a reason. But he made his way up and grabbed it. An old homelite super mini. To my surprise the rope pulled over and had compression. He wanted it so I said throw it in the truck, maybe it would be a winter project. Well today I had the gas can in my hand so I dribbled some gas in it and pulled it over. Nothing. Pulled plug wire and threw in plug I just took out of trimmer, spark. Now I was interested. Pulled spark plug put it in wire, no spark. Now I’m thinking did someone really throw this out over a plug? Replaced plug with the trimmer plug, dumped out old gas, checked fuel filter, line seemed decent. Fuelled up and she fired right up. Lol.
